Oceaneering Secures Multi-Year GTA Job from BP

Oceaneering will provide support for this contract using a multi-purpose vessel equipped with two of its work-class ROVs. The project will also involve management, engineering, and integration services delivered by Oceaneering’s local and international teams. Engineering and pre-mobilization activities have started, and field operations are anticipated to begin in the second quarter of 2025. The contract is initially set for three years, with two additional one-year extension options available.

Oceaneering Net Income Soars for Q1

“Oceaneering outperformed expectations this quarter due to resilient utilization of remotely operated vehicles (ROVs), and strong vessel activity, predominately in the Gulf of Mexico and West Africa. We generated adjusted EBITDA of $96.7 million, exceeding both our guidance range and consensus estimates for the quarter”, Rod Larson, President and Chief Executive Officer of Oceaneering, stated. He added that the jump in revenue was driven by strong performances from the company’s Subsea Robotics (SSR) and Offshore Projects Group (OPG).
